Paying for college.


Your editorial "What Bootstraps?" (March 25) dealt with a critical issue: the rising cost of higher education higher education

 for millions of young adults from families of modest means. You're right, it is troubling that some public universities, as well as private universities, are becoming so expensive, but I thought you'd like to know that a few public universities (not simply Harvard and Yale, as you mentioned) are trying to address this problem.

Also known as The University of North Carolina, Carolina, North Carolina, or simply UNC  has initiated an effort, called Carolina Covenant, designed to make the university accessible to students from low-income families. (I'm not involved in this program, though I know people who are.)  of grants and scholarships. At first the university targeted families with incomes of up to 150 percent of the federal poverty level, but now it is extended to families at 200 percent. By fall 2005, the university expects to serve 345 students in this program.
